ORDER

[Order of the Court was made by R.SUBRAMANIAN, J.] Prayer in the Writ Petition reads as follows:- ''To issue a Writ of Mandamus, directing the respondents to keep intact the 13 fair price shops running under the Naduvankurichi Primary Agricultural Credit Societies, on the basis of the representation sent by the petitioner dated 29.08.2024, within the time frame as fixed by this Court.''

2. The Joint Registrar of Co-operative Societies / the third respondent herein has filed a counter affidavit, wherein it has been stated that the decision to transfer the management of the fair price shops to the District Consumer Co-

operative Wholesale Store, has been taken mainly because the Naduvakurichi Primary Agricultural Co-operative Credit Society, which is at present running the shops, has suffered huge losses and the accumulated loss in the financial year 2022-2023 is about Rs.1.81 Crores. The decision as to whether the fair price shops should be run by the District Co-operative Society or by a particular Cooperative Society is essentially a policy decision, which has to be taken by the authorities depending on the ground situation. We do not think that this Court can interfere with the said decision, even though it is contended that the loss is not from the fair price shops, but it is from the other activities of the Society.

3. The third respondent in his counter affidavit has further stated that the location of the fair price shops will not be shifted. Therefore, there is no inconvenience to the public.

4. The Writ Petition is, therefore, dismissed. No costs. Consequently, connected Miscellaneous Petition is closed.
